Daily Deals and Specials
No daily deals or specials at this time.
Tri-City Country Club
129 S Henson Rd
Villa Grove, IL 61956
Phone: 217-832-9782
No daily deals or specials at this time.
129 S Henson Rd
Villa Grove, IL 61956
Phone: 217-832-9782